Werder Bremen managing director Clemens Fritz says the club have had no approach from Leeds United for Romano Schmid, addressing weekend speculation around the midfielder.

"No one has contacted us about Romano. We are currently not expecting a transfer in the winter and are planning with him for the rest of the season," he told Bild.

Leeds had been admirers of Schmid and were thought to have spoken with his representatives before shelving January interest after Buonanotte arrived on loan.

Schmid has two goals and five assists in 17 Bundesliga appearances this season for Bremen.

The 31-cap Austria international is under contract until 2027.
